Transaction 6590121a21735467f63e9f7ff570ec848c448a0ed065a04e71b7cb9a85ee47b8

1 Input
2 Outputs
  • 6590121a21735467f63e9f7ff570ec848c448a0ed065a04e71b7cb9a85ee47b8:0
  • value  2285
    address  1CbpqyDyVw3YdPdXaXm4pCD6xHuPhrwrej
  • 6590121a21735467f63e9f7ff570ec848c448a0ed065a04e71b7cb9a85ee47b8:1
  • value  22593170
    address  3FNXnnP28vH72DZRyAoptcz7XvPCpfnQZt